LLDPE – Linear Low Density Polyethylene

Polyethylene, which is used in the production of many distinctive products, is one of the thermoplastic types. There are many types of polyethylene, created by using the ethylene. One of these, and often preferred type, LLDPE – linear low density polyethylene (LLDPE) is used since it provides a polymer structure that causes the density to drop during the crystallization phase. There are many advantages of this type.

What is Linear Low Density Polyethylene (LLDPE)

Linear Low Density Polyethylene, produced with different technologies, can be at standard and medium density levels by providing low gel levels. Since it ensures a high output rating for all the injection and extrusion technologies, it is suitable for pharmaceutical and food standards.

The melting point of Linear Low Density Polyethylene is typically 105-115° C. Accordingly, it can be used continuously between 105 – 115° C.

Linear Low Density Polyethylene Properties and Uses

The most significant characteristics and advantage of Linear Low Density Polyethylene are that it is remarkably resistant against impact. Since it has a linear structure, it presents different properties from other Polyethylene types. Its tensile strength and level of elongation are higher than the other types. It is also semitransparent and opaque. The main uses of Linear Low Density Polyethylene are as follows:

  • Garbage bags
  • Plastic films
  • Agricultural bulk bag
  • Grocery bags
  • PVC canvas
  • Textile products containers
  • Containers
  • Blowing and molding products
  • Portable Cabins
  • Trash barrel
